Monetization: How Much Does It Cost To Use Beehiiv

This set’s huge. Due to the fact that even if you start your e-newsletter just for fun, eventually you might think … Could this actually earn money?

Substack makes it simple to charge for registrations. You just established a price, and boom– individuals can pay you to access premium content. But below’s the twist: Substack takes 10% of your incomes, plus payment processor costs. That accumulates fast.

And when it involves advertisements? Substack’s not constructed for that. If you intend to run ads or partner with sponsors, you’ll be handling it by hand– negotiating deals, tracking clicks, all that behind the curtain job. It’s feasible, sure, yet far from smooth.

Currently Beehiiv? It’s almost built for money making. You can run paid e-newsletters (without giving Beehiiv a cut), launch a referral program, join their advertisement network, and even set up “pay what you want” or lifetime subscriptions. And also, they simply presented a killer control panel that helps you track ad earnings and see what’s carrying out.

The only downside? You require to be on a paid plan to access a lot of these features.

Decision: Beehiiv takes this. You’ll pay upfront, but you maintain more over time and obtain way much more monetization tools.

Checklist Administration & Automation: Who Assists You Range?

Right here’s the important things– Substack isn’t truly developed for advanced email marketing. You can not mark customers, construct sequences, or section based on actions. You send out e-mails to your whole checklist or to your paid belows. That’s it.

So if you’re seeking to develop a sales funnel, nurture collection, and even just segment readers by passion? Not gon na happen on Substack.

Beehiiv, on the other hand, gives you correct email marketing power. You can segment customers based upon sign-up type, habits, or custom fields. You can even automate series, routine follow-ups, and drip material gradually. It’s not quite as robust as ConvertKit or ActiveCampaign, yet it’s miles ahead of Substack.

Decision: Beehiiv, no question. If automation and segmentation matter to you, Substack won’t cut it.

Pricing: Which One Injures the Wallet Much Less?

This’s a little bit challenging.

Substack is technically totally free– up until you begin charging for registrations. After that they take 10%, which may not feel like much until you start gaining real cash.

Beehiiv begins free, too– yet their free plan caps out at 2,500 customers and doesn’t include money making features. Once you desire access to the advertisement network or automation tools, you’ll require to leap to their Scale plan (beginning at $49/month for 1,000 subs and scaling up).

Verdict: If you want to monetize today with marginal setup, Substack’s much easier. But long-term, Beehiiv gives you much more control over your earnings.
